Title: View of lunarscape at Station 4 with Astronaut Schmitt working at LRV
Description:
A view of the lunarscape at Station 4 (Shorty Crater) showing
Scientist-Astronaut Harrison H. Schmitt working at the lunar roving vehicle
(LRV) during the second Apollo 17 extravehicular activity (EVA-2) at the
Taurus-Littrow landing site. This is the area where Schmitt first spotted
the orange soil. Orange soil is clearly visible on either side of the
rover in this picture. Shorty Crater is to the right. The peak in the
center background is Family Mountain. Portion of South Massif is on the
horizon at the left edge.
